我正试图按照这instructions条安装NVM

我在终端中输入了以下命令:

$ curl https://raw.github.com/creationix/nvm/master/install.sh | sh

运行安装后,我重新启动终端并try 安装 node .使用以下命令:

$ nvm install 0.8

但我得到的回应是:

-bash: nvm: command not found

我不确定我做错了什么.

其他信息--

我一直在寻找其他帖子和论坛的解决方案.我找到了另一个解决方案

$ git clone git://github.com/creationix/nvm.git ~/.nvm

但每次我这么做都会失败.任何帮助都将不胜感激.谢谢

推荐答案

判断您的.bash_profile.zshrc.profile文件.您很可能在安装过程中遇到问题.

在其中一个文件的末尾应该有以下内容.

[[ -s $HOME/.nvm/nvm.sh ]] && . $HOME/.nvm/nvm.sh  # This loads NVM

. $HOME/.nvm/nvm.shsource $HOME/.nvm/nvm.sh一样

见:Sourcing a File

您还可以查看是否有.nvm个文件夹.

ls -a | grep .nvm

如果缺少该文件夹,则安装无法运行git命令.这可能是因为背后有一个代理人.试着运行以下命令.

git clone http://github.com/creationix/nvm.git .nvm

Node.js相关问答推荐

try 使用Puppeteer抓取Twitter时数组空

在Android Studio中react 本机构建失败:未正确检测到Node.js版本

Mongoose抱怨说,整数是数字,而不是整数

如何在医学中按patientId查找一个并同时插入多个数据

函数声明中的异步在没有等待的函数中做什么?

如何从 Mongo Atlas 触发器向 GCP PubSub 发出经过身份验证的请求

更新 mongodb 中的交易值

Google App Engine 突然不允许我部署我的 node.js 应用程序

安装样式组件时出现react 错误

当try 将 formData 转换为 express js 时,服务器无法识别 multipart/form-data

express app.post的多个参数在Node.js中的定义是什么

mongoose 7.0.3 使用运算符 $and 严格搜索日期

多字段传递获取查询失败

Mocha调用所有it回调模拟(测试中间件)

Node.js |如何在微服务之间转发标头?

来自 child_process.exec 的错误没有这样的设备或地址,管道有帮助.为什么?

如何为一个网站实现这 2 个网址.即 www.administrator.sitename.com 和 www.sitename.com?

带有 node.js 和 express 的基本网络服务器,用于提供 html 文件和assets资源

从 zip 文件在 AWS 中创建 lambda 函数

Javascript在try块内设置const变量